Kenya gives elephants more room
NAIROBI AFP — Kenyan wildlife authorities resumed the relocation of hundreds of elephants from an overcrowded reserve in Kenya's coastal region to a more spacious park further inland, officials said. The second phase of the relocation from the Shimba Hills National Reserve to Tsavo East National Park, about 300 kilometers...

Kenya plans massive elephant translocation to ease human-wildlife conflict
NAIROBI AFP ? The Kenya Wildlife Service KWS announced it planned to move about 400 elephants from a reserve in the coastal region where they have been straying into human settlements and destroying crops. "KWS intends to translocate 400 jumbos from the Shimba Hills National Reserve to Tsavo East...
